What is Litecoin (LTC)?

Litecoin (LTC) is a decentralized cryptocurrency created by Charlie Lee, a former Google engineer. It was designed to be faster and lighter than Bitcoin, with a block time of 2.5 minutes compared to Bitcoin’s 10-minute block time. LTC has a limited supply of 84 million coins, which should help it maintain its value over time.
